Transaction c3bd6d088f5565197c2ffa1a0713b3d75066328010e1564af43301b5e901db1f
1 Input
1 Output
-
c3bd6d088f5565197c2ffa1a0713b3d75066328010e1564af43301b5e901db1f:0
- value
- 514332313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ff00ae1f75fc3d806bf0e3be66be8bec3be0f0a5 OP_EQUAL
- address
- 3QwM3igFXimCLnqYLXjZPU64Mn3usv75PD